    For me the key is that this initial drilling for LRS did three things in the initial assays - been hoping the initial assays showed we had a good kaolin/halloysite deposit to do further drilling. The key to a kaolin/halloysite deposit is three fold:
    1. Grain size - less than 45um is the key.
    2 Brightness - over 80% is fantastic meaning the resource is 'whiteness'. 75% - 80% is good/ok
    3. Low deleterious elements, especially iron, which in part is also associated with high brightness. If you have brightness above 80% the probability is you'll have low deleterious elements. Fe203 needs to be below 1%.

    Whilst a little bit of a mixed bag, on this basis for an initial drill program the results are very good as there were some very good and good consistent hits. Now subsequent drilling needs to strengthen those results by targeting areas where results were particularly good. Obviously the geological hypothesis is also a key here as well as establishing that map that layers the results so that can see the areas of plus 10% halloysite, where nice koalin results are, nice grind size of 45um or less and low deleterious elements occurs.
